The video explores the research conducted at the Susquehanna Shale Hills Observatory, focusing on understanding the water cycle. Scientists and engineers use various instruments to study precipitation, transpiration, and the role of geology in water movement. The research aims to improve predictions of floods and droughts, especially in the context of climate change. Collaboration with European researchers and support from the National Science Foundation are highlighted as key components of this effort.
